not an immediate situation, but does anyhow else not respond well to injectibles?

we did IUI in '07 that was cancelled. the protocol was
Buserelin 0.3ml per day from day 2
Puregon 50iu starting day 2 or 3.

If I remeber rght, first scan was cd 7, no follies, just cysts. cd 10 was the same, dose upped to 75iu. cd 13 scan still no follies. Was then reweighed and because I'd gone back up to 14st (had to get to 12-7 to do it) I was cancelled.


just before starting cd3 results: tsh 2.4, lh 11, fsh 6.8, prolactin 166.

anyone else had a poor response? have you then been able to get a decent response? does it seem like the weight could really make that much difference?
